Trdelník is Rust based testing framework providing several convenient developer tools for testing Solana programs written in Anchor.

Installation

Currently Trdelnik is only available as a beta release, we are working hard toward the first official release coming within a few days.

```shell cargo install trdelnik-cli

or the specific version

cargo install --version trdelnik-cli ```

Usage

```shell

navigate to your project root directory

trdelnik init

it will generate .program_client and trdelnik-tests directories with all the necessary files

trdelnik test

want more?

trdelnik --help ```

How to write tests?

``rust // <my_project>/trdelnik-tests/tests/test.rs // @todo: do not forget to add all necessary dependencies to the generatedtrdelnik-tests/Cargo.toml` use programclient::myinstruction; use trdelnikclient::*; use myprogram;

[throws]

[fixture]

async fn initfixture() -> Fixture { // create a test fixture let mut fixture = Fixture { client: Client::new(systemkeypair(0)), program: programkeypair(1), state: keypair(42), }; // deploy a tested program fixture.deploy().await?; // call instruction init myinstruction::initialize( &fixture.client, fixture.state.pubkey(), fixture.client.payer().pubkey(), System::id(), Some(fixture.state.clone()), ).await?; fixture }

[trdelnik_test]

async fn testhappypath(#[future] initfixture: Result) { let fixture = initfixture.await?; // call the instruction myinstruction::dosomething( &fixture.client, "dummystring".toowned(), fixture.state.pubkey(), None, ).await?; // check the test result let state = fixture.getstate().await?; asserteq!(state.something_changed, "yes"); } ```

Testing programs with associated token accounts

```toml

/trdelnik-tests/Cargo.toml

import the correct versions manually

anchor-spl = "0.24.2" spl-associated-token-account = "1.0.3" ```

```rust // /trdelnik-tests/tests/test.rs use anchorspl::token::Token; use splassociatedtokenaccount;

async fn initfixture() -> Fixture { // ... let account = keypair(1); let mint = keypair(2); // constructs a token mint client .createtokenmint(&mint, mint.pubkey(), None, 0) .await?; // constructs associated token account let tokenaccount = client .createassociatedtokenaccount(&account, mint.pubkey()) .await?; let associatedtokenprogram = splassociatedtokenaccount::id(); // derives the associated token account address for the given wallet and mint let associatedtokenaddress = splassociatedtokenaccount::getassociatedtokenaddress(&account.pubkey(), mint); Fixture { // ... token_program: Token::id(), } } ```
